Understanding a Power Glider Recliner

Before exploring maintenance tips, understanding the components of a power glider recliner is essential. These recliners feature intricate mechanical parts, various upholstery materials (such as leather, fabric, microfiber, or faux leather), and often include electrical components like motors or heating elements. Each component necessitates specific care methods to uphold its condition and performance.

Cleaning Upholstery Materials

Cleaning methods vary based on the recliner’s upholstery material:

  • Leather: Regularly dust with a dry cloth and use a leather conditioner or mild soap solution for deeper cleaning. Always test cleaners in a hidden area and avoid harsh chemicals.
  • Fabric or Microfiber: Vacuum frequently to prevent debris buildup and promptly blot spills with a dry cloth. Use a fabric cleaner or mild soap solution for stains, testing first in an inconspicuous spot.
  • Faux Leather: Clean with a mild soap solution or specialized cleaner designed for faux leather. Avoid abrasive cleaners and test in an unseen area.

Addressing spills promptly helps prevent lasting damage to upholstery. Always adhere to the manufacturer’s cleaning guidelines for tailored recommendations.

Maintaining Mechanical Parts

Regular maintenance of mechanical components ensures smooth operation:

  • Regular Inspection: Periodically check springs, bearings, and hinges for wear, rust, or damage. Address issues promptly to prevent further deterioration.
  • Lubrication: Apply appropriate lubricant to moving parts to reduce friction and noise. Avoid over-lubricating to prevent dust and debris accumulation.
  • Professional Servicing: Seek professional help if unusual noises or operational issues arise to prevent worsening problems.

Caring for Electrical Components

For recliners with electrical features like USB ports or heating elements, cautious handling is crucial:

  • Avoid Liquids: Keep liquids away from the recliner to prevent spills that could damage electrical components.
  • Avoid Overloading: Be mindful of USB port usage to avoid stressing the recliner’s electrical system.

Additional Protection Tips

  • Protective Covers: Consider using covers designed for recliners to shield against spills, pet hair, and dirt. Many covers are machine washable for convenience.
  • Throws or Blankets: Enhance style and protect against spills with easily removable throws or blankets.
  • UV Protection: Shield recliners from sun damage with blinds, curtains, or UV-protective films if near windows.
